Consumer confidence improves for second straight month

People shop for goods at Wang Lang market near Siriraj Hospital in Bangkok on Sept 11. (Photo: Apichart Jinakul)

Consumer confidence rose for a second straight month in September, following a clearer political landscape in the country, but concerns about global economic prospects linger.

The University of the Thai Chamber of Commerce (UTCC) reported on Monday that the consumer confidence index rose to 58.7 in September, up from 56.9 in August and 55.6 in…
